v模型是软件开发模型吗?揭秘5大关键点助你快速理解

发布日期:2025-10-17 01:44浏览次数:

今天早上起来,我在公司上班的路上就在琢磨这个V模型,到底是啥玩意儿?软件开发模型听起来很高大上,可我总感觉它挺复杂的。之前项目里用了不少工具,老是出问题,搞得一团糟,我就想搞明白V模型是啥来头。

我的疑问开始了

上周我们团队接了个新活儿,做个小App,老大说要采用"V模型"的方式来干活。我一听就懵了——这不就是个开发软件的流程嘛为啥非得叫模型?是不是跟搭积木一样,一层一层往上堆?我跑去问同事,张三说这就是个花哨的名字,李四又说它能帮咱省时间。意见不一,弄得我更头大。得,自己动手丰衣足食,我决定了:今天非把它搞透不可!我翻开笔记本,打开电脑,开始在论坛上瞎逛。

摸索着实践过程

我先看了几篇别人写的帖子,一堆专业名词砸过来,脑袋嗡嗡响。索性扔一边,我用自己的笨法子干:重新理清我们那个小App的项目。第一步,我拿了一张大白纸,左边写"要做的事",右边写"怎么检查"。比如,左边是"设计界面",右边立刻添上"测试界面的样子会不会出错"。我模拟着干,边做边画图。

中间出过笑话——有一次,我太心急,直接把代码写完了才想起来测试的事,结果发现个错儿,可晚了!改起来费老大劲。这才悟到:V模型就是要你早动手、早检查。我又试了试拆分步骤,把一个大活儿切成小块,左边加一块开发,右边立马跟上测试。磨叽了一天,我终于摸着点门道:它不是啥神秘模型,就是一个带套路的干活方式。

总结的五大关键点

经过这么一通折腾,我把它归纳成五个大点,保准帮你快速看明白。记住了,这玩意儿就是开发软件的一种规矩,别想太复杂!

  • 第一点:它基于老办法,不是新的发明。跟瀑布模型差不多,都得一步步走,左半拉做开发,右半拉搞测试。
  • 第二点:提早动手测试。别等做完了才测试,每个阶段都配上检查,错误就能早抓住。
  • 第三点:左边开发右边测试对应。像搭积木一样,左边搭一块开发,右边就有一块测试卡在那儿。
  • 第四点:帮你少折腾、省时间。一早就找问题,免得后来大动干戈,搞出麻烦。
  • 第五点:适合稳定的活儿。要是项目老变来变去,它就用不顺手,反倒成了拖累。

为啥我这么有把握?说出来不怕你笑话。去年我们公司瞎折腾,搞了个乱七八糟的项目,没用这模型,结果上线后问题一堆,团队吵翻天。这回我提前按V模型规矩试了一把,明显顺溜多了。

现在想想,这事儿真不算啥高深的知识。关键在于自己动手、多试几次。弄懂了它,下次干活我就心里有底了!希望你这会儿也看明白了点儿?有啥问题,评论区聊聊。

如果您有什么问题,欢迎咨询技术员 点击QQ咨询